#4f5425 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4f5425 is composed of 31% red, 32.9% green and 14.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 6% cyan, 0% magenta, 56% yellow and 67.1% black. It has a hue angle of 66.4 degrees, a saturation of 38.8% and a lightness of 23.7%. #4f5425 color hex could be obtained by blending #9ea84a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

● #4f5425 color description : Very dark desaturated yellow.
#4f5425 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4f5425 has RGB values of R:79, G:84, B:37 and CMYK values of C:0.06, M:0, Y:0.56, K:0.67. Its decimal value is 5198885.

Shades and Tints of #4f5425
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020201 is the darkest color, while #f9faf4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#4f5425
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3d3d3c is the less saturated color, while #697504 is the most saturated one.
